## Upgrading Quillbus (broker)

Welcome aboard! Upgrading our message broker, Quillbus, is mostly painless if you do it node by node. Drain the node first, wait for consumers to rebalance (usually under two minutes), then apply the new package and rejoin. Don't upgrade more than one node per availability cell at a time — we learned that the hard way. Before you start, double-check the broker's current settings, listed here.

settings of fafog-haduf:
ZORIX_PIN=4648
ZORIX_METRICS_HOST=metrics.zorix.paliqsys.corp
ZORIX_LOG_LEVEL=info
ZORIX_TENANT=druix

Leadership Review Briefing — Board

The revised commission scheme for Oreston Systems launches next quarter. Base commission drops to 4%; accelerators begin at 110% of quota. Modeled payout is cost-neutral at current attainment, with upside capped at 2.5x. Top-performer retention risk was assessed as low. Rollout communications start month-end. The strategic reasoning behind the timing appears below.

board note of bajop-yaweg: The western region missed its Pelys quota by 58.0 percent last quarter. Pelysek Foods plans to raise the Belius list price by 44.0 percent in July. The steering committee signed off on a budget of $133.8 million for Project Pelax. The renewal with Zoraelix Systems closes at $61.9 million a year, 12.7 percent above the last contract.

**09:40** — Cutover from the homegrown Tindercask job queue to Relaywick completed. Reviewer note: the shim in `queue/compat` translates legacy enqueue calls and is deliberately temporary; please don't approve new callers against it. Dual-write mode ran clean for six hours before we flipped reads. The cutover build's trace token is recorded below.

build token for yajof-bajof: htk31_506ff1188f74596b5bb2eec94edc43c